RedHat 9.0, SAMBA 3.0.0beta3
I'm having problems unmounting a remote SMB share, and I'd like to get it unmounted without resorting to rebooting the linux system. The problem I get when trying to unmount it:
[EMAIL PROTECTED] pristic01]# umount share_images
umount: share_images: can't write superblock
I also can;t go into the directory:
bash: cd: share_images: Input/output error
Does anyone know any tricks to forcefully unmount the directory?
